New rules under the Home Affordable Refinance Program may allow you to apply for a new mortgage, even if you owe more than what your home is worth. Many homeowners tried unsuccessfully to refinance, until this new program was introduced. Check it out and see if it can help you.

Don’t go charging up a storm while you are waiting for your mortgage to close. Lenders generally check your credit a couple of days prior to the loan closing. If there are significant changes to your credit, lenders may deny your loan. Once you’ve signed the contract, then you can spend more.

You should always ask for the full disclosure of the mortgage policies, in writing. This ought to encompass closing costs and other fees. The majority of companies are open about their fees, but there are some that conceal charges until the last minute.
